easyuidemo(EasyUIDemo Introduction)

2023-07-31T11:24:15

EasyUIDemo: Introduction

In this article, we will explore the features and functionalities of EasyUI, a powerful and user-friendly JavaScript-based UI library. EasyUI provides a wide range of UI components and widgets, allowing developers to create responsive and interactive web applications with ease.

EasyUI Components

EasyUI offers a variety of pre-built UI components that can be easily integrated into your web application. These components include but are not limited to:

  • DataGrid: A powerful grid control that allows for easy data manipulation and display.
  • Tree: A hierarchical tree control that enables the display of data in a tree structure.
  • Form: A form component that simplifies the process of creating and validating input forms.
  • Window: A window container that can be used to display modal or non-modal dialog boxes.
  • Accordion: A collapsible container that organizes content in a vertical accordion style.

These components can be easily customized and configured to meet the specific requirements of your application.

EasyUI Features

EasyUI offers a wide range of features that make it a popular choice among developers. Let's take a look at some of its key features:

1. Easy Integration

EasyUI can be seamlessly integrated with other JavaScript frameworks and libraries, such as jQuery and AngularJS. This allows developers to leverage the existing knowledge and capabilities of these frameworks while enjoying the benefits of EasyUI components.

2. Cross-browser Compatibility

EasyUI is designed to be compatible with major web browsers, ensuring that your web application works consistently across different platforms and devices.

3. Responsive Design

All EasyUI components are built with responsive design principles in mind. They automatically adjust their layout and behavior based on the screen size and resolution, providing an optimal user experience on both desktop and mobile devices.

4. Theming Support

EasyUI comes with a built-in theming system that allows you to easily change the look and feel of your web application. You can choose from a variety of predefined themes or customize your own, providing a consistent and visually appealing user interface.

5. Rich Set of APIs

EasyUI provides a comprehensive set of APIs that allow developers to interact with the UI components programmatically. This enables dynamic updates and customization of the components based on user actions or application logic.

Getting Started with EasyUI

To get started with EasyUI, you need to include the necessary JavaScript and CSS files in your HTML page. You can either download the library files and host them locally or include them from a content delivery network (CDN).

Once the library files are included, you can start using EasyUI components by simply adding the corresponding HTML markup and initializing them using JavaScript. The official EasyUI documentation provides detailed examples and tutorials to help you understand and utilize the library effectively.

Conclusion

EasyUI is a powerful and versatile UI library that simplifies the development of web applications. Its extensive range of components, rich features, and easy integration make it a popular choice among developers. Whether you are a beginner or an experienced developer, EasyUI can greatly speed up the development process and enhance the user experience of your web applications.

So why wait? Start exploring the features of EasyUI and see how it can take your web applications to the next level!